Stegall is an unincorporated community in Jackson County, Arkansas, United States.

Stegall is located at 35°36′26″N 91°08′24″W (35.607302, -91.140125).[1]

Stegall Arkansas was officially created in 1905 [2] when Perry P. Stegall applied for a post office for the small community, 8 miles (13 km) east of the county seat Newport on Arkansas Highway 384.
in 1942 [2] the Stegall community school was annexed into Newport Arkansas 72112.
